Understanding AI Order Accuracy Tracking Solutions
AI order accuracy tracking solutions have emerged as a game-changer for businesses aiming to optimize their operational efficiency. These advanced systems leverage machine learning algorithms to monitor and analyze every step of the order fulfillment process, from intake to delivery. By continuously assessing performance data, AI models can quickly identify bottlenecks, errors, or inefficiencies within operations. This allows businesses to make data-driven adjustments in real time, improving overall accuracy rates and customer satisfaction.
The key advantage lies in their ability to provide unparalleled visibility into order management. Through the integration of sensors, IoT devices, and robust software platforms, these solutions capture detailed insights on inventory levels, order processing times, and delivery routes. Armed with this granular data, businesses can forecast demand more accurately, streamline workflows, and even predict potential issues before they arise. This proactive approach to order accuracy tracking ultimately enables organizations to enhance productivity, reduce costs, and ensure a seamless customer experience.

Measuring Success: Key Performance Indicators for AI Optimization
Measuring success is a critical aspect of any optimization process, and AI business operational efficiency is no exception. To evaluate the effectiveness of AI implementations, key performance indicators (KPIs) should be established. These KPIs provide insights into the tangible benefits brought about by AI integration, such as improved order accuracy tracking solutions. By monitoring metrics like order fulfillment rate, error reduction, and processing time, businesses can quantify the impact of AI on operational efficiency.
For instance, a significant KPI for AI order accuracy tracking solutions could be the percentage of correct orders processed. A decline in errors over time would indicate successful optimization, allowing companies to make data-driven adjustments and continuously enhance their processes. Additionally, tracking the time taken to resolve customer queries related to orders can highlight areas where AI has streamlined operations, ensuring both customer satisfaction and efficient business functioning.
